2/3 + 9/12 add fractions with unlike denominators

Answer:

1\frac{5}{12}

Step-by-step explanation:

\frac{2}{3} + \frac{9}{12}   <-- let's change 2/3 into a fraction that has 12 as the denominator

\frac{2}{3} × 4   <-- multiply both the numerator and the denominator by 4

2 × 4 = 8   <-- new numerator

3 × 4 = 12   <-- new denominator

now we have \frac{8}{12} + \frac{9}{12}

\frac{8}{12} + \frac{9}{12} = \frac{17}{12}    <-- let's change it into a mixed number

17 ÷ 12 = 1\frac{5}{12}

A rectangular picture frame has perimeter of 58 inches. The height of the frame is 18 inches. What is the width of the frame?
Stells [14]

Answer:

11 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

A rectangle's perimeter can be found using:

p=2l+2w

We know that the perimeter, p, is 58, and the length/height is 18. Therefore, we can substitute those values in

58=2(18)+2w

Multiply 2 and 18

58=36+2w

Since we want to find the width, we need to get w by itself. First, subtract 26 from both sides

58-36=36-36+2w

22=2w

Since w is being multiplied by 2, divide both sides by 2. This will cancel out the 2, and leave w by itself.

22/2=2w/2

11=w

So, the width is 11 inches
